Late 19th-Century Baccarat Cut Crystal Alcove Chandelier
Splendid and imposing late 19th-century Napoleon III-style ceiling-mounted globe chandelier made of very high-quality cut crystal
Attributed to Baccarat; a late 19th-century period model, unsigned as it predates 1936 and was originally marked with paper labels that are now missing
A remarkable piece of crystal cut in a diamond-point pattern, ending in flat, radiating ribs at the top
Acid-etched frosted crystal finish
The crystal is heavy, very clear, and possesses a crystalline resonance
Sold with its original mounting ring; we do not have the chains or the electrical wiring
Total height 30 cm
Maximum diameter of the globe 20 cm
The crystal has no chips or cracks; the bronze mount is in good condition
